Inventory Clerk
We are looking for a meticulous and organized Inventory Clerk to join our team on a long-term contract basis in San Francisco, California. In this role, you will be responsible for managing and maintaining the textile sample supply closet while supporting inventory operations throughout our design studio. This position is essential in ensuring that the design team has access to well-organized and accurately tracked materials, contributing to the overall efficiency of our creative processes.<br><br>Responsibilities:<br>• Organize and maintain the textile sample closet, ensuring all materials are labeled and stored in an accessible manner.<br>• Record new textile samples into the inventory management system promptly and accurately.<br>• Monitor inventory levels and coordinate the reordering of supplies and samples as needed.<br>• Assist designers by sourcing and preparing sample sets for client presentations.<br>• Welcome and professionally interact with clients visiting the studio, ensuring a positive experience.<br>• Manage incoming shipments, verifying contents and properly storing newly delivered materials.<br>• Use ladders safely to access and organize materials located on high shelves.<br>• Collaborate with the operations and design teams to complete ad-hoc inventory or administrative tasks.<br>• Ensure the workspace remains clean, organized, and conducive to productivity.
• Previous experience in inventory management, office organization, or a related field is preferred.<br>• Strong organizational skills with a keen eye for detail.<br>• Interest in textiles, interior design, or a related creative field is an advantage.<br>• Physical ability to lift boxes and safely use ladders to reach elevated storage areas.<br>• Proficiency in learning and using inventory or sample management software.<br>• Excellent communication skills and a collaborative, team-focused attitude.<br>• Ability to work on-site in a dynamic, design-oriented studio environment.<br>• Comfortable with tasks requiring standing, bending, and lifting up to 25 pounds.
